Dubai Marina is best seen from above, and the 1-kilometer XLine gives you a fast, clear view of its towers, canals, and waterfront. You can ride solo or share the experience with a partner or friend, reaching speeds of up to 80 km/h. I like the direct route from Amwaj Towers to Dubai Marina Mall, which turns a short activity into a memorable look at the district.

I also like the strong focus on safety and smooth operation, along with the fact that only your own group takes part. The main drawback is the strict 100-kilogram limit, which has caused real disappointment at check-in. Finding the start point can also take extra time, and the transfer option may not offer the best value.

Key points to know before you book

  • A 1-kilometer flight over Dubai Marina: The route crosses the district from Amwaj Towers to Dubai Marina Mall.
  • Speeds of up to 80 km/h: This is a quick adrenaline ride, not a slow sightseeing trip.
  • Ages 12 to 65 are accepted: Riders must also weigh between 50 and 100 kilograms.
  • The activity itself lasts about 15 minutes: Allow extra time for arrival, checks, preparation, and boarding.
  • Solo or shared riding is possible: You can go alone or ride with someone close to you.
  • Transfers are optional: Pickup is offered, but some customers found the transport cost high compared with the short activity.

Flying above Dubai Marina instead of walking beside it

Dubai Marina is famous for its wall of modern towers, waterfront paths, canals, and luxury buildings. A walk lets you study the architecture at street level, while a dhow cruise gives you time on the water. The XLine offers something different: a quick diagonal view across the district from high above.

The route begins at Amwaj Towers and finishes at Dubai Marina Mall. That point-to-point design matters. You are not simply riding over a small amusement park or repeating a short circuit. You cross a recognizable part of Dubai, with the marina below and the skyline spread around you.

The ride reaches up to 80 km/h, so the best part is the contrast between speed and scenery. You have enough time to take in the buildings and waterfront, but not enough to casually study every detail. I would treat it as an adrenaline activity with sightseeing benefits, not as a full architectural tour.

At roughly 15 minutes, the experience is brief. That timing usually works well in a busy Dubai schedule, especially if you are fitting it between the beach, shopping, a marina walk, or another attraction. Just remember that the quoted duration refers to the activity itself. You need additional time for getting to the right entrance, weighing, preparation, and the actual launch process.

The route from Amwaj Towers to Dubai Marina Mall

Your experience begins at XLine Dubai Marina, at Dubai Marina Mall. The supplied meeting information identifies the start point as Dubai Marina Mall, while the ride itself launches from Amwaj Towers. That distinction is worth noting because the area has large buildings, roads, walkways, and several possible entrances.

One of the most useful practical tips is to allow time to find the exact location. The start can be harder to locate than expected, and arriving at the mall area is not the same as being ready at the correct XLine point. If you are using a taxi or public transport, show the driver the full XLine Dubai Marina and Dubai Marina Mall details rather than relying on a general Dubai Marina destination.

The flight carries you over the marina toward the mall. Below, you can expect views of the canals, tall residential and hotel buildings, and the polished waterfront district. The changing angle gives you a better sense of how closely the towers, roads, water, and walkways fit together.

You do not get a long stop at a separate viewpoint. The zipline is the viewpoint. That makes the experience ideal if you want a dramatic look at Dubai Marina without spending an hour on a cruise, but less suitable if you prefer slow photography or relaxed sightseeing.

What the 80 km/h ride feels like

The speed is the main reason to book. At up to 80 km/h, the flight has genuine force and momentum, yet it remains short enough for most people to handle as a single burst of excitement. The movement is the attraction, and the city view gives it a strong sense of place.

You can ride solo or with someone such as a partner or friend. A shared ride can make the experience more social, while a solo ride lets you focus on the view and the sensation of crossing the marina. The information provided does not specify how every shared ride is arranged, so confirm the setup at booking if riding together is important to you.

The best view will likely be in front of you and below, but you should not expect to calmly turn in every direction throughout the ride. At speed, the towers pass quickly. If photographs matter, ask what the operator permits before the flight and keep your attention on the instructions.

Safety is a clear strength of the operation. Several customers described the staff as helpful and said the process went smoothly, with safety treated as a priority. That does not remove the need to follow every instruction, but it should reassure first-time zipline riders who feel nervous about the launch.

Weight rules are not a minor detail

The most important booking issue is the weight limit. Riders must weigh between 50 and 100 kilograms, with 100 kilograms listed as the maximum. The age range is 12 to 65.

Do not treat the limit as a rough guide. The operator has weighed people at the hotel and then checked them again at the start point. A person who appeared to be under the limit earlier was refused after weighing more at the launch area. That led to frustration and disputes over refunds.

Your weight can vary depending on clothing, shoes, meals, and the time of day. If you are close to 100 kilograms, assume the limit will be enforced and contact the provider before paying. Use kilograms when checking your weight, since a small difference can matter. The stated maximum is also commonly expressed as about 220 pounds, but the official rule is 100 kilograms.

This is one point where I would not take a chance. A rejected rider may lose the chance to participate, and the cancellation terms do not promise a refund for being over the limit at the last moment. Make sure every person in your group understands the rule before you book.

Safety checks, staff, and the private group format

The activity is listed as a private tour or activity, meaning only your group participates. That is useful for couples, families with eligible children, and small groups of friends who want to manage the experience together rather than join a large sightseeing party.

The staff handle the practical steps before the flight, including the required checks and preparation. Feedback about the team was strongly positive, with specific praise for their attitude and attention to safety. The service appears to be one of the better parts of the experience.

Still, a private group does not mean you can ignore the schedule or requirements. Everyone must arrive ready, meet the age and weight rules, and follow the operator’s instructions. The short flight leaves little room to sort out missing information at the last minute.

The age rule also shapes who should book. Children under 12 cannot participate, and adults older than 65 are outside the stated range. The information does not give a separate exception process, so do not assume one will be available.

Is the optional transfer worth the extra cost?

Pickup is offered, which can simplify the day if you are staying outside Dubai Marina or do not want to work out the route yourself. This is particularly useful for visitors unfamiliar with Dubai’s huge malls, towers, and multilayered roads.

The transfer option is not automatically the best value. The listed price is $280.64 per person, and some customers felt the transportation charge was unusually high compared with the activity. One complaint also described a dirty vehicle. The provider responded that vehicle cleanliness would be checked and improved.

That feedback gives you a practical choice. If you are already staying near Dubai Marina or can reach Dubai Marina Mall easily, arranging your own transport may make more financial sense. If you are staying farther away, value the convenience of pickup, or are traveling with a group, the transfer could be worth considering.

Check exactly what the price includes before you pay. The experience price and the transfer cost may feel very different when separated. A short 15-minute ride can still be worth a high price if it is a top priority, but you should not book it expecting a full-day tour or extensive transportation service.

How the $280.64 price measures up

At $280.64 per person, this is an expensive short activity. You are paying for the location, the specialized equipment, safety staff, a famous urban route, and the chance to see Dubai Marina from an unusual angle. The price is easier to justify if you specifically want a major adrenaline activity in Dubai.

It is harder to justify if your main goal is simply to see the marina. A walk along the waterfront costs far less, and a dhow cruise gives you more time for sightseeing. The XLine earns its price through the rush and the route, not through duration.

I would compare the cost with the rest of your Dubai plans. If you are building a trip around memorable, high-energy activities, this can be a strong choice. If you are watching your budget, book only if the zipline itself is more appealing than other attractions you could buy with the same money.

Group discounts may help, although the available information does not state the exact discount or eligibility rules. Ask before booking if several people in your party plan to ride. Since the experience is private for your group, the arrangement may work well for friends or families who want to share the occasion.

Booking ahead and handling cancellations

This activity is booked, on average, 48 days in advance. That suggests you should plan ahead if the XLine is important to your schedule, especially if you need a particular date or are coordinating several people.

You can cancel for a full refund up to 24 hours before the start time. Any cancellation made less than 24 hours before the activity is not refundable, and changes within that same 24-hour window are not accepted. The cut-off follows Dubai local time.

That policy makes the weight check especially important. Confirm eligibility before booking, not after arriving. It also makes sense to avoid scheduling the zipline immediately before a flight or another fixed reservation, since a late change could leave you with little flexibility.

Confirmation is provided at booking. Public transportation is nearby, and most people can participate if they meet the age and weight rules.

Who will enjoy the XLine most

I would recommend this experience to you if you want a short, intense activity with a strong city setting. It suits couples, friends, and families with children aged 12 or older who meet the weight requirement. It also works well for repeat visitors who have already seen Dubai Marina from the ground and want a new angle.

It is a good match for someone who likes controlled thrills but does not want to give up sightseeing. The skyline, canals, and waterfront give the ride a clear sense of place. You are not simply flying over an anonymous course.

I would be more cautious if you dislike heights, are near the weight limit, need a slow photography experience, or are mainly looking for value per minute. The activity is over quickly, and the transfer may add a cost that does not suit every budget.

Also think about the rest of your day. The ride itself is short, but the location makes it easy to combine with Dubai Marina Mall or a walk along the waterfront. The meeting point and end point are connected to the marina area, so you can continue sightseeing afterward rather than crossing the city for a single brief event.

My call: book it for the flight, not the sightseeing time

Book the XLine Dubai Marina if the idea of speeding 1 kilometer above one of Dubai’s most recognizable districts excites you. The strongest reasons are the unusual route, the 80 km/h top speed, the skyline views, the private group format, and staff who appear to take safety seriously.

Before paying, confirm four things: every rider is 12 to 65, every rider weighs 50 to 100 kilograms, you know exactly where to meet, and the transfer price suits your budget. If those points are clear, this is a sharp, memorable addition to a Dubai itinerary.

If you want long sightseeing time or the lowest-cost view of the marina, choose a walk or cruise instead. The XLine is a premium burst of adrenaline with scenery attached, and it works best when you judge it on those terms.

FAQ

Where does the XLine Dubai Marina experience start?

The meeting point is XLine Dubai Marina at Dubai Marina Mall, Dubai Marina, Dubai. The ride launches from Amwaj Towers and ends at Dubai Marina Mall.

How long does the zipline activity last?

The activity lasts approximately 15 minutes. You should allow extra time for arrival, weighing, preparation, and boarding.

How fast does the zipline go?

The zipline reaches speeds of up to 80 kilometers per hour, or about 50 miles per hour.

What age range can participate?

Participants must be between 12 and 65 years old.

Is there a weight limit?

Yes. Riders must weigh between 50 and 100 kilograms. The maximum is strictly listed as 100 kilograms.

Can I ride with another person?

You can choose to ride solo or with someone such as a partner or friend. Confirm the shared riding arrangement when booking if this matters to your group.

Can I cancel for a refund?

You can cancel at least 24 hours before the experience start time for a full refund. Cancellations or changes made less than 24 hours before the start are not accepted for a refund.
